Description

Written by one of the leading physicians of the 19th century, this groundbreaking work provides a comprehensive overview of diseases of the abdomen. From gastritis to peritonitis, it covers all major conditions of the alimentary canal and their treatments. With detailed case studies and insightful analysis, this book remains an invaluable resource for medical professionals and students.
